A bit about us

We are an independent, registered charity providing front line support to young people and people experiencing homelessness to open up pathways out of poverty and homelessness - breaking the cycle of disadvantage. Our focus is on respect, client-centred care, and harm prevention so people can lead longer lives, have improved health, meaningful employment, and a greater sense of belonging, safety, and security through our holistic model of care.  

This is (some) of what we got up to:  

  • Supported more than 2,864 young people across our youth outreach, employment, training and social enterprise programs into work, education and re-engaged back into the community. 
  • Took our youth outreach out to the West in response to an emerging mental and social wellbeing crisis whilst still supporting 422 young people in the North. 
  • Sold over 250,000 coffees at The Little Social and re-invested over $100K back into youth and homelessness services here at Youth Projects. 
  • Experienced 12,497 client visits at The Living Room – with the number of people dropping-in each day, doubling. 
  • Shared over 8,875+ meals, 14,471+ practical supports and over 2,678 health promotion + counselling sessions at The Living Room 
  • After hours, our Night Nurses provided 3,243 episodes of care and our NSPs saw almost 15,000 contacts. 
  • And… we opened our fourth social enterprise café at the Victorian Pride Centre, re-opened The Living Room as a world-class centre AND launched The Little Social Catering Co. too! 

 You can read more in our Impact Report or you’ll find us right across Naarm/Melbourne with our main hubs located in Glenroy, Sunshine, Werribee, Melton and on Hosier Lane in the heart of the city.
